Bern, 6.-7. 10. 2003COST 723 WG1 Meeting 1Stefan Buehler 6 Platform InstrumentLaunch DMSP F-13SSM-T2 March 95 DMSP F-14 SSM-T2 April 97 NOAA-15 (NOAA-K) AMSU-B May 1998 NOAA-16 (NOAA-L) AMSU-B September 2000 NOAA-17 (NOAA-M) AMSU-B June 2002 Aqua HSB May 2002 Operational Microwave Humidity Data

Bern, 6.-7. 10. 2003COST 723 WG1 Meeting 1Stefan Buehler 11 Match-up Procedure Problems: –Sonde drifts during ascent –Time difference between sonde launch and overpass Pixel level comparison not possible Figure by V. Oommen-John
12
Bern, 6.-7. 10. 2003COST 723 WG1 Meeting 1Stefan Buehler 12 Solution: Look at a target area, we take a 50km circle. Striking: Atmospheric inhomogeneity can be a problem. Figure by M. Kuvatov
13
Bern, 6.-7. 10. 2003COST 723 WG1 Meeting 1Stefan Buehler 13 Number of Occurrences Standard deviation of brightness temperatures inside the target area. Vertical lines are from operational calibration. Figure by V. Oommen-John
14
Bern, 6.-7. 10. 2003COST 723 WG1 Meeting 1Stefan Buehler 14 Error Model The 50km inhomogeneity is the dominant error source. Error model: i = C 0 + 50km C 0 is small, we take 0.5K.
15
Bern, 6.-7. 10. 2003COST 723 WG1 Meeting 1Stefan Buehler 15 Comparison Lindenberg radiosonde humidity vs. AMSU- B on NOAA15, time period 2002. Discrepancies in the UT for very dry conditions. Figure by M. Kuvatov

Bern, 6.-7. 10. 2003COST 723 WG1 Meeting 1Stefan Buehler 18 Conclusions It is worthwhile to compare operational satellite humidity data and radiosondes. Comparison in radiance space avoids inverse problem. A good match-up methodology is crucial. Tests consistency of: RT Model Satellite Data Radiosonde Data
